Many beautiful general terms and concepts are airlines still free, such as Fernreisen.aero, Flugreisen.aero, and so on can register since the 2nd 2002, the IATA CODE of two letters as aero-domain.

Airports can also register their three letter IATA-code see .aero. These domains have already been pre-registered by SITA and must by be registered the authorized airports only at the Registrar. Airlines and airports can register their industry codes in addition to .aero also under special official subdomains \”airports.aero\” or \”airlines.aero\”.
